This is one of modern museum buildings in India, architecture and the quality of construction are excellent—a rear thing in India. Only a few galleries are open. I understand collection is being shifted from the old Patna Museum to this building. Visit has to start with a short film on the museum itself. Though still being populated; its has many priceless collections pictures of which are attached to this review. It is locate in the heart of Patna, capital of Bihar state. A must visit place. Only drawback is that they do not have guides or audio guides.

I recently visited Bihar Museum over a week-end during my visit to Patna. I am very impressed with the way Bihar Museum has been created and maintained. It has exceeded my expectations!
The entry fee is Rs.100 for adult Indian citizen. It is spacious and centrally air-conditioned. The museum displays Bihar's culture from ancient time till date. One must visit this museum while in Patna. It is worth visiting. It takes around 2-4 hours to go through all rooms/halls in the museum.

We visited the Bihar Museum in February and were delighted to see a truly world-class site in Patna dedicated to conveying the story of Bihar. The building was absolutely phenomenal. The exhibit rooms are, safe to say, still being filled and properly curated. There is clearly a tremendous amount to tell about Bihar. The initial room provided an excellent timeline of Bihar, with exhibits. The larger exhibit rooms, however, are under-filled, and not properly/completely lighted. In the smaller exhibits about diaspora, sometimes consist of just posterboards with pictures and text. A good start but sustained and comprehensive investment and curation will keep the museum on an upward trajectory.
The childrens section is delightful and worth taking the kids to. The movie in the exceptional theater room is slick and very well-done. I look forward to coming back to see more. It's a real asset to Patna, and more generally, Bihar.

When you see the ticket price of â‚ą100 it seems a bit on the higher side. But, when you enter the museum, it seems worth it. This place is still under construction and it will surely become one of the best attractions of Patna when it is completed.
There is an auditorium where you can get to watch a small documentary on all the stuff kept in the museum and some history of Bihar.
Overall, once done, this will become a must see attraction at Patna.

Built by Maki & Associates, this is one of its kind modern day museum in the city of Patna. It has different galleries associated with various timelines and also a children's gallery area. It also houses Didarganj Yakshi, one of the treasured artifacts from Mauryan times, apart from innumerable statues of ancient as well as medieval era. The gallery on Bihari diaspora called Girmitiya is good as well as folk art gallery. There is usually some art or cultural event going on in the museum.
